Titania
tih-TAHN-yuh
✦ Meaning
“Latin feminine form of Titan, the name of the Fairy Queen in Shakespeare's A Midsummer Night's Dream, meaning divine and majestic.”
Popularity Over Time
Titania is not currently in the US top 1000.
